HTTP/1.1 404 Not Found

ORIGIN HOST: 18.207.104.87
TARGET HOST: www.sandiegosubaru.com
TARGET PAGE: /new/Subaru/2018-Subaru-Impreza-38b62a4c0a0e0a6b3ba2fdb4b65c9891.htm




Copyright © Vercara, LLC.
All Rights Reserved